Emily Mortimer, co-founder

Emily Mortimer is an actor, director, screenwriter and producer. She most recently wrote and directed an adaptation of Nancy Mitford’s novel THE PURSUIT OF LOVE for the BBC and Amazon. Mortimer’s currently co-writing a script with Noah Baumbach, is set to direct her first feature film for A24 and is performing in the film PADDINGTON IN PERU.

Mortimer’s break-out performance came in Nicole Holofcener’s critically acclaimed, LOVELY AND AMAZING which won her an Independent Spirit Award. She has been nominated by the London Film Critics Circle for her performance in YOUNG ADAM, the Goya awards for her role in THE BOOKSHOP, and the Baftas for THE PURSUIT OF LOVE. 

Mortimer’s television credits include two seasons of HBO’s DOLL & EM, co-written by and co-starring her friend Dolly Wells. She starred opposite Jeff Daniels in THE NEWSROOM and had a recurring role on 30 ROCK. She’ll next appear in THE NEW LOOK for Apple opposite Juliette Binoche. 

As a film actor she has worked with some of the greats, including Martin Scorsese (SHUTTER ISLAND, HUGO), Woody Allen (MATCH POINT) and Rob Marshall (MARY POPPINS RETURNS) among many others.

Alessandro Nivola, co-founder

Alessandro Nivola is an award winning actor and producer.  On Broadway he received Tony and Outer Critics Circle Award nominations for his performance opposite Bradley Cooper in THE ELEPHANT MAN and a Drama Desk Award nomination for A MONTH IN THE COUNTRY opposite Helen Mirren. For Sebastian Lelio’s film DISOBEDIENCE opposite Rachel Weisz, he won the 2018 British Independent Film Award (BIFA) and was nominated for a London Critics Circle Award, and a UK National Film Award. He was nominated for an Independent Spirit Award for Lisa Cholodenko’s LAUREL CANYON and won a SAG Award and a Critics Choice Award for David O Russell’s AMERICAN HUSTLE.  He won the 2017 Tribeca Film Festival Best Actor Award and the Achievement in Acting Award at the 2009 Provincetown International Film Festival. 

Nivola was most recently seen as Dickie Moltisanti, the lead role in the Warner Bros. SOPRANOS prequel feature THE MANY SAINTS OF NEWARK and in David O Russell’s film AMSTERDAM with Christian Bale and Margot Robbie. He will next be seen starring opposite Keira Knightley in Matt Ruskin’s feature BOSTON STRANGLER, opposite Russell Crowe, Aaron Taylor Johnson and Ariana DeBose in JC Chandor’s Marvel feature KRAVEN THE HUNTER, and opposite Adrien Brody in Brady Corbet’s film THE BRUTALIST. He also co-stars with André Holland in the Apple+ limited series THE BIG CIGAR, directed by Don Cheadle and set to air fall 2023.

Lizzie Nastro, Head of Development

Lizzie Nastro spent nine years at IFC Films as Director of Acquisitions before becoming an independent producer and heading development at King Bee. Her producing credits include SKATE KITCHEN, a feature film written and directed by Crystal Moselle which premiered at the 2018 Sundance Film Festival and was released by Magnolia Pictures. She was a producer on the HBO TV series BETTY. Additionally, she produced three short films with writer/director Chloë Sevigny, which had premieres at Cannes and Venice. Previously, she produced I AM A TOWN, a documentary feature directed by Mischa Richter, which premiered at MoMA Doc Fortnight, the short documentary, BRIAN ANDERSON ON BEING A GAY PRO SKATEBOARDER for Vice and THE WANNABE, a film directed by Nick Sandow starring Patricia Arquette and Vincent Piazza.

Some of the films she acquired while at IFC include Lena Dunham’s TINY FURNITURE, MEDICINE FOR MELONCHOLY directed by Barry Jenkins, and THE PLEASURE OF BEING ROBBED by the Safdie Brothers. She was a 2017 Sundance producing summit fellow.
